About The Willows at Red Oak Recovery
The Willows at Red Oak Recovery is a women only, ages 18-35 treatment center with a goal to better the lives of young women for the long run. Their focus on gender allows them to tailor their programs specifically for what is most effective for women. They provide individualized, person-centered substance abuse, trauma, and co-occurring mental health treatment, as well as eating disorder support. Some therapies they use include c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T), dialectical behavioral therapy (DBT), eye movement desensitization and reprocessing (EMDR), rational emotive behavioral therapy (REBT), and relapse prevention education.
The Willows helps young women learn how to establish better nutritional and physical health, identify and deal with stress in a positive way, increase their self-esteem, develop a greater sense of purpose and self, and reconnect with their families. They achieve this through their blend of evidence-based practices with holistic practices. Another benefit of going to a center like The Willows at Red Oak Recovery is the easy access to nature. They include activities such as yoga, canoeing, horseback riding, and fly fishing into their program. They additionally provide aftercare support programs and an alumni network to help their clients even after they leave the facility.
